Basic Information: The occupational benzene poisoning data reported in the province from 2006 to 2018 showed that the incidence was relatively higher in 2013, with 21 cases, accounting for 14.48% of the total reported cases. A total of 145 cases of occupational benzene poisoning were reported in the past 13 years, including 140 cases of occupational chronic benzene poisoning, accounting for 96.55% of the total reported cases, 5 cases of acute benzene poisoning and 28 cases of benzene-induced leukemia. In terms of the cases of benzene-induced leukemia, 28 cases were reported during 13 years, mainly distributed in 2007, 2013 and 2015, 11 cases in total, accounting for 39.29% of the total reported cases(Table 1, Figure 1) . It is apparent from figure 1 that a great majority of cases were found in 2013. The number of cases fluctuated by year and it has no evident tendency of growth or decrease.

- Industry distribution: The data from 2006-2018 report of occupational benzene poisoning and benzene leukemia indicates that most of the cases were found in the manufacturing, the occupational benzene poisoning patients accounted for 89.7% of the total cases, chronic benzene poisoning patients accounted for 90.7% of the total cases, benzene-induced leukemia accounts for 85.7% of the total cases, other cases were distributed respectively in leasing and business services, construction, retail trade, transportation, warehousing and postal service, accommodation and catering industry and public management, entertainment and social organization.

- The distribution of enterprise scale and economic type : The cases of occupational benzene poisoning and benzene-induced leukemia diagnosed in Jiangsu Province from 2006 to 2018 were mainly concentrated in small-scale enterprises. There were 40 cases of chronic benzene poisoning and 5 cases of benzene-induced leukemia. In large-scale enterprises, there were 28 cases of chronic benzene poisoning, 1 case of acute benzene poisoning and 2 cases of benzene-induced leukemia. There were only 2 cases of chronic benzene poisoning and 1 case of benzene-induced leukemia in tiny enterprises. The information of ten cases of chronic benzene poisoning and one case of acute benzene poisoning is unknown. (Table 3, Figure 2)
Divided by economic type, cases are mainly concentrated in private enterprises, state-owned enterprises and foreign enterprises, among which private enterprises account for a relatively high proportion. Benzene poisoning patients in private enterprises account for 44.2% of the total cases of chronic benzene poisoning, benzene-induced leukemia accounts for up to 57.1% of the total cases, and all acute benzene poisoning cases were found in private enterprises except for one unknown case. The number of chronic benzene poisoning cases in state-owned enterprises, foreign enterprises and collective enterprises is 38, 34 and 5 respectively. Among the other cases of benzene-induced leukemia, 5 occurred in foreign businesses, 4 in state-owned enterprises, 2 in collective enterprises, and 1 unknown. (Table 4, Figure 3)

3. Distribution of gender, age and length of exposure: Among the occupational benzene poisoning cases in Jiangsu province from 2006 to 2018, the cases of acute benzene poisoning was mainly male with 4 cases, accounting for 80% of the total cases, while the cases of chronic benzene poisoning was mainly female with 91 cases, accounting for 65% of the total cases. The number of male and female patients with benzene-induced leukemia was similar, 16 and 12 respectively.(Table 5)
The age of occupational benzene poisoning patients was mainly distributed in the age group of 30-49 years old, and the number of patients accounted for 80%. This age group has a higher incidence of benzene-induced leukemia, with 19 patients, accounting for 67.9% of the total. (Table 6)
Among the cases of benzene-induced leukemia in Jiangsu province from 2006 to 2018 , workers with 1-19 year has the highest percentage of length of service of benzene poisoning patients, accounting for 82.9% of the total, cases of acute benzene poisoning were all found in the workers with a contact length of less than nine years. The cases of chronic benzene poisoning mainly concentrated in workers with a contact length of 1-19 years, with 111 patients, accounting for 79.3% of the total cases. In addition to 2 patients of benzene-induced leukemia with the working age of 30-34 years, the remaining cases were all distributed in workers with a working age of 1-24 years, especially in workers with a working age of 1-14 years, with 21 cases, accounting for 75% of the total cases.(Table 7, Figure 4)

4. Distribution of contact concentration: According to the data of occupational benzene poisoning from 2006 to 2018, the exposure concentration of acute benzene poisoning patients is unknown. Among 140 patients with chronic benzene poisoning, the contact concentration of 48 patients is unknown, and the benzene exposure concentration of 56 patients is less than 0.6 mg/m³ , accounting for 40% of the total. The number of cases in 1 to 3 mg/m³ was relatively higher , with 19 people, accounting for 13.6% of the total. There were 6, 4 and 7 people with contact concentration of 0.6-1mg/m³, 3-6mg/m³ and more than 6mg/m³ respectively. The reported data of benzene-induced leukemia from 2006 to 2018 showed that in addition to 7 patients with unknown exposure concentration, the most patients with exposure concentration below 0.6mg/m³ were 6 patients, 5 patients with exposure concentration above 0.6mg/m³ and 6mg/m³, and 3 and 1 patients with exposure concentration between 1 and 3mg/m³ and 3 and 6 mg/m³ respectively.
